Why Use a Zoom Background?

Before we get into the nitty-gritty of Indonesian-themed backgrounds, let's quickly talk about why using a Zoom background is a great idea in the first place. First off, privacy! Not everyone needs to see your messy room or what's going on behind you. A virtual background keeps things professional and private. Secondly, it’s a fantastic way to express yourself and add a bit of personality to your meetings. A cool background can be a great conversation starter and make you more memorable. Finally, it's just plain fun! Who wouldn't want to pretend they're on a tropical beach in Bali while discussing spreadsheets?

Iconic Indonesian Landmarks as Zoom Backgrounds

Indonesia is brimming with incredible landmarks. What better way to showcase the nation's beauty than by using these as your Zoom backgrounds? Imagine dialling into your meeting with the majestic Borobudur Temple as your backdrop. This 9th-century Mahayana Buddhist temple is not only a UNESCO World Heritage site but also a stunning architectural marvel. The intricate carvings and serene atmosphere make it a perfect, calming background.

Or how about the breathtaking views of Mount Bromo? The active volcano in East Java offers a dramatic and awe-inspiring landscape. The misty sunrises and the rugged terrain will definitely make you stand out. Plus, it shows you appreciate the raw, natural beauty of Indonesia. For a touch of paradise, you could use a background of Uluwatu Temple in Bali. Perched on a cliff overlooking the Indian Ocean, this temple provides a stunning vista, especially during sunset. The crashing waves and the silhouette of the temple create a mesmerizing backdrop that’s both calming and impressive. These landmark backgrounds not only add visual appeal but also subtly introduce Indonesian culture and heritage to your colleagues or clients. Sharing these iconic scenes can spark interest and even lead to conversations about Indonesian tourism and culture. Moreover, it helps promote a positive image of Indonesia, showcasing its rich history and natural wonders. So, next time you're looking for a background, consider these landmarks to add a touch of Indonesian grandeur to your virtual meetings.

Natural Indonesian Landscapes

Let's be real, Indonesia is blessed with some seriously stunning natural landscapes. Think lush rainforests, pristine beaches, and vibrant coral reefs. These make fantastic Zoom backgrounds, transporting you and your colleagues to paradise (even if you're just talking about quarterly reports).

Picture this: you're in a meeting, and behind you is a crystal-clear shot of Raja Ampat. The turquoise waters, the scattering of islands, and the rich marine life create an underwater wonderland that is both captivating and inspiring. It’s like bringing a slice of tropical heaven to your workspace. Or maybe you're more of a mountain person? A backdrop of the rice terraces in Ubud, Bali, could be just the ticket. The vibrant green fields, meticulously carved into the hillsides, offer a serene and calming view. It’s a great way to add a touch of tranquility to your meetings, especially when things get stressful. If beaches are your thing, you can't go wrong with a background of Pink Beach (Pantai Merah) in Komodo National Park. The unique pink sands, combined with the clear blue waters, create a striking and unforgettable visual. It’s a guaranteed conversation starter and a great way to showcase the unique beauty of Indonesia’s coastline. These natural landscape backgrounds are not only visually appealing but also convey a sense of peace and tranquility. They subtly remind everyone of the importance of nature and can even promote a sense of wanderlust. Sharing these stunning scenes can also spark interest in eco-tourism and conservation efforts in Indonesia. So, next time you want to impress or simply add a touch of serenity to your meetings, consider using one of these natural wonders as your Zoom background.

Cultural Icons and Motifs

Indonesia's rich cultural heritage offers a treasure trove of inspiration for Zoom backgrounds. From intricate batik patterns to traditional dances, there's something to suit every taste and style.

Consider using a background featuring a detailed batik pattern. Batik is an Indonesian wax-resist dyeing technique that produces stunning and intricate designs. A batik background not only adds a touch of elegance but also showcases Indonesia’s artistic heritage. The complex patterns and vibrant colors can be a great way to add visual interest to your meetings. Or how about a background depicting a traditional Indonesian dance, such as the Balinese Kecak dance or the Javanese Gamelan? These performances are rich in symbolism and cultural significance. A dance background can add a dynamic and captivating element to your meetings, showcasing the vibrancy and diversity of Indonesian culture. For a more subtle touch, you could use a background featuring traditional Indonesian motifs, such as the Garuda (the national symbol of Indonesia) or the Kris (an asymmetrical dagger with cultural significance). These symbols are deeply rooted in Indonesian history and mythology. They can add a touch of authenticity and cultural depth to your virtual presence. These cultural backgrounds not only add visual appeal but also serve as a conversation starter, allowing you to share insights into Indonesian traditions and customs. They help promote cultural understanding and appreciation, making your meetings more engaging and informative. So, next time you're looking for a background that reflects your appreciation for Indonesian culture, consider using one of these cultural icons or motifs.

How to Find and Use Zoom Backgrounds

Okay, so you're sold on the idea of using an Indonesian-themed Zoom background. Great! But how do you actually find and use one? Don't worry, it's super easy.

First, finding the right image is key. You can start by searching on Google Images, Pexels, or Unsplash. Just type in keywords like "Indonesia background," "Bali scenery," or "Batik pattern." Make sure the image is high-resolution (at least 1920x1080 pixels) so it looks crisp and clear during your meetings. Once you've found the perfect image, download it to your computer. Next, open your Zoom application and go to Settings. You'll find this by clicking on your profile picture in the top right corner and selecting "Settings" from the dropdown menu. In the Settings menu, click on Backgrounds & Filters. Here, you'll see a few default backgrounds provided by Zoom. To add your own, click the + button below the video preview and select "Add Image." Then, navigate to the location where you saved your Indonesian background and select it. Voila! Your chosen background should now appear behind you in the video preview. You can also upload multiple backgrounds and switch between them as you please. One important thing to note is the "I have a green screen" option. If you have a physical green screen behind you, check this box for the best results. If not, Zoom will still do its best to separate you from the background, but the effect might not be as perfect. Experiment with different images and settings to find what works best for you. And don't be afraid to get creative! The possibilities are endless when it comes to Zoom backgrounds.

Tips for the Perfect Zoom Background

Alright, you've got your Indonesian background picked out and uploaded to Zoom. Awesome! But before you jump into your next meeting, here are a few tips to make sure your background looks its best.

  • Good Lighting is Key: Make sure your face is well-lit. Natural light is best, but if that’s not available, use a desk lamp or ring light. Avoid having light sources behind you, as this can create a silhouette effect.
  • Choose High-Quality Images: As mentioned earlier, use high-resolution images to avoid pixelation. A blurry background can be distracting and unprofessional.
  • Consider Your Outfit: Try to wear clothing that contrasts with your background. If your background is very colorful, opt for neutral-colored clothing. If your background is more subdued, you can wear brighter colors.
  • Test Your Background: Before your meeting, test your background to make sure it looks good from all angles. Move around a bit to see if there are any glitches or distortions.
  • Keep it Professional: While it's fun to show off your personality, make sure your background is appropriate for the meeting. Avoid anything too distracting or offensive.
  • Update Regularly: Don't be afraid to change your background every now and then to keep things fresh and interesting.

By following these tips, you can ensure that your Indonesian-themed Zoom background looks polished and professional, adding a touch of Indonesian flair to your virtual meetings.
